Flat roof replacement by roof size: El Centro vs Fresno
Flat and low-slope roofs are priced per square (100 sq ft) and run about $3–$11 per sq ft installed, depending on the membrane. The roof area is close to the footprint since there's little pitch.

Where does a smart roofing budget go in 2026?
Tear-off vs. overlay, shingle tier and what's hidden under the deck decide the real number. Our editors on the trade-offs.
The do-it-right case
Skipping the tear-off means burying whatever's failing underneath, and a second layer bakes the shingles from below until they curl early. Doing it properly means stripping to the deck, then paying for real underlayment, flashing and airflow — the work that sets how long the roof lasts, not just how it looks the first week.
The risk case
The surprise that wrecks a roofing budget is rot in the decking, and you rarely see it until the old shingles come off. Fix the price per replacement sheet in the contract before the crew starts, so a low bid can't quietly climb once the deck is open.
The value case
Architectural shingles hit the sweet spot — far more durable than 3-tab for a modest premium, and far cheaper than metal or tile. For most homes they're the right default.
Insist on tear-off over overlay, get the deck-repair rate in writing before work starts, and lean toward architectural shingles. Skipping any of the three tends to cost more later than it saves now.
